Fantasy was the title used by two separate UK sf magazines of the 1930s and 1940s.

The first was a pulp edited by T. Stanhope Sprigg]and published by George Newnes Ltd. There were three undated issues in 1938 and 1939.

The second was a digest edited by Wally Gillings and published by the Temple Bar Publishing Co. It also saw three issues between December 1946 and April and August 1947.
